Key Responsibilities• Collect, analyze, and interpret healthcare data from multiple sources, including clinical, claims, and administrative systems. • Develop and maintain dashboards, visualizations, and detailed reports using tools such as Power BI, Tableau, or Excel. • Perform statistical analyses to identify trends, variances, and opportunities for process improvement in healthcare operations.• Partner with business and clinical teams to define key performance indicators (KPIs) and monitor outcomes against organizational goals. • Ensure accuracy, consistency, and completeness of data across various databases and systems. • Support data-driven decision-making by providing meaningful insights and recommendations to leadership. • Participate in data validation, quality assurance checks, and process documentation. • Maintain confidentiality and compliance with HIPAA and other healthcare data regulations.• Continuously evaluate new data technologies and methodologies to enhance analytical efficiency. Required Skills and Qualifications• Bachelor’s degree in Data Analytics, Health Informatics, Statistics, Computer Science, or a related field (Master’s degree preferred). • Strong proficiency in SQL, Excel, and one or more data visualization tools (Tableau, Power BI, QlikView, etc.). • Solid understanding of healthcare datasets (claims, EHR, member, or provider data). • Experience in data cleaning, validation, and statistical modeling using Python, R, or SAS.• Excellent analytical and problem-solving skills with strong attention to detail. • Knowledge of healthcare terminologies such as ICD-10, CPT, and DRG codes. • Effective communication skills, both written and verbal, with the ability to present complex data in a clear and actionable manner. • Ability to work independently and manage multiple projects in a fast-paced environment. Experience• Minimum 2–4 years of experience as a Data Analyst, preferably in a healthcare or insurance environment. • Hands-on experience in managing large datasets and building data pipelines.• Familiarity with healthcare reporting standards, performance measurement, and regulatory compliance (CMS, NCQA, etc.) is highly desirable.
